2022最新ZigBee技术支持下智能家居系统构建论文

ZigBee技术支持下智能家居系统构建论文ZigBee技术支持下智能家居系统构建论文0引言随着电子技术在现实生活中的广泛应用,智能家居应运而生。智能家居是以住宅为平台,利用计算机技术、网络通讯技术将与家庭生活有关的设备结合起来,通过无线网络实现远程监控,它在保持了传统居住功能的基础上,提供了全方位的信息交换功能,优化了人们的生活方式和居住环境。在智能家居中,通信网络是整个系统的核心,采用无线组网方式使得网络通信更加灵活、成本更低,其逐渐成为智能家居的主流趋势。ZigBee技术是基于IEEE802.15.4标准的一种低功耗、低速率、低成本的无线网络通信技术,具有强大的组网功能,在智能家居中运用广泛。本系统设计的智能家居系统是通过ZigBee技术组建的无线网络与嵌入式WEB服务器通信,用户只需通过访问Web浏览器,就可达到对家庭环境数据的监测和对家电设备的控制,非常方便与高效。1系统设计方案系统主要包括ZigBee无线网络和嵌入式WEB服务器,系统结构图如图1所示。ZigBee无线网络遵循TI公司的ZigBee2022协议栈Z-Stack,采用星型拓扑结构,包括协调器与终端节点[1].协调器负责组建家庭内部无线网络,接收终端节点发来的传感器数据,通过串口将数据发送给嵌入式WEB服务器,并转发服务器的控制命令给终端节点。终端节点采集环境数据通过无线网络发送给协调器,并接收协调器的控制命令并执行。终端节点连接温湿度传感器、烟雾传感器、热释电传感器、光照度传感器等,用于测量家庭环境数据,连接继电器模块控制家用电器。嵌入式WEB服务器设计是在STM32微控制器上移植TCP/IP协议,通过串口与ZigBee协调器通信,通过以太网接口接入监控网络,用户使用电脑、手机等监控设备与终端设备交互。2系统硬件设计2.1ZigBee无线网络硬件设计ZigBee模块采用TI公司的CC2530单片机。CC2530单片机集成了8051增强型内核微控制器、RF射频收发器、片内可编程闪存、8KRAM、5通道DMA、8路12位分辨率AD等强大功能的一款射频单片机[2].2.1.1终端节点设计终端节点测量家庭环境温度、湿度、烟雾浓度、红外感应信号、光照强度等数据,并传递给协调器,接收协调器发回的命令来控制家用电器.硬件结构图如图2所示。终端节点连接的传感器模块有温湿度传感器、烟雾传感器、热释电传感器、光照度传感器。温湿度传感器采用DHT11,它是1款含有已校准数字信号输出的温湿度复合传感器,包括1个电阻式感湿元件和1个NTC测温元件,并与1个高性能8位单片机相连接,具有响应快、抗干扰能力强、性价比高等优点。DHT11通过单总线直接与CC2530的P1.1引脚相连接。烟雾传感器采用MQ-2,它的探测范围广、灵敏度高、响应快、稳定性强,可用于液化气、甲烷、丙烷、丁烷、酒精、烟雾等气体的泄漏监测。MQ-2与CC2530的P0.7引脚相连接。热释电传感器采用HC-SR501人体红外感应模块,它能检测人发射的红外线,从而判断家中是否有人。HC-SR501与CC2530的P0.5引脚相连接。光照传感器采用光敏电阻,光敏电阻使用半导体材料制作,利用内光电效应工作,它在光线的作用下其阻值减小,在黑暗的环境里,它的电阻值增高。光敏电阻与CC2530的P0.1引脚相连接。控制模块采用继电器SRD-05VDC-SL-C来控制大功率的电器设备,继电器与CC2530的P1.5引脚相连接。2.1.2协调器设计ZigBee协调器负责调度各节点工作,其通过串口连接STM32单片机的USART2,在设置好相应的波特率等参数后,通过TXD和RXD引脚与STM32通信,转发传感器数据与接收控制命令。协调器与STM32的通信接口电路如图3所示。2.2嵌入式WEB服务器硬件设计2.2.1微控制器模块微控制器采用了STM32增强型单片机STM32F103VET6,具有高性能、低功耗的优势,其工作频率可达到72MHz,具有内置高速存储器、128K字节的闪存、20K字节的SRAM、丰富的增强I/O端口和外设,2个12位的ADC、3个通用16位定时器、1个PWM定时器,还包含先进的通信接口:2个I2C和SPI、3个USART、1个USB和1个CAN.2.2.2以太网接口模块以太网接口采用了ENC28J60芯片,ENC28J60是带SPI接口的独立以太网控制器,它集成了MAC和10BASE-TPHY、接收器和冲突抑制电路,支持全双工和半双工模式,最高速度可达10Mb/s的'SPI接口,内置8KB发送/接...

1、当您付费下载文档后,您只拥有了使用权限,并不意味着购买了版权,文档只能用于自身使用,不得用于其他商业用途(如 [转卖]进行直接盈利或[编辑后售卖]进行间接盈利)。
2、本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供参考,付费前请自行鉴别。
3、如文档内容存在侵犯商业秘密、侵犯著作权等,请点击“举报”。

常见问题具体如下:

1、问:已经付过费的文档可以多次下载吗?

      答:可以。登陆您已经付过费的账号,付过费的文档可以免费进行多次下载。

2、问:已经付过费的文档不知下载到什么地方去了?

     答:电脑端-浏览器下载列表里可以找到;手机端-文件管理或下载里可以找到。

            如以上两种方式都没有找到,请提供您的交易单号或截图及接收文档的邮箱等有效信息,发送到客服邮箱,客服经核实后,会将您已经付过费的文档即时发到您邮箱。

注:微信交易号是以“420000”开头的28位数字;

       支付宝交易号是以“2024XXXX”交易日期开头的28位数字。

客服邮箱:

biganzikefu@outlook.com

所有的文档都被视为“模板”,用于写作参考,下载前须认真查看,确认无误后再购买;

文档大部份都是可以预览的,笔杆子文库无法对文档的真实性、完整性、准确性以及专业性等问题提供审核和保证,请慎重购买;

文档的总页数、文档格式和文档大小以系统显示为准(内容中显示的页数不一定正确),网站客服只以系统显示的页数、文件格式、文档大小作为依据;

如果您还有什么不清楚的或需要我们协助,可以联系客服邮箱:

biganzikefu@outlook.com

常见问题具体如下:

1、问:已经付过费的文档可以多次下载吗?

      答:可以。登陆您已经付过费的账号,付过费的文档可以免费进行多次下载。

2、问:已经付过费的文档不知下载到什么地方去了?

     答:电脑端-浏览器下载列表里可以找到;手机端-文件管理或下载里可以找到。

            如以上两种方式都没有找到,请提供您的交易单号或截图及接收文档的邮箱等有效信息,发送到客服邮箱,客服经核实后,会将您已经付过费的文档即时发到您邮箱。

注:微信交易号是以“420000”开头的28位数字;

       支付宝交易号是以“2024XXXX”交易日期开头的28位数字。

确认删除?